      Duties will include manufacturing of electronic parts in a lean manufacturing, high-compliance environment. Assigned tasks will include thorough visual inspections under a microscope using fine hand skills and constant use of detailed work instructions written in English.

      • Using a torque screwdriver to fasten components into place.
      • Using an arbor press to press pins into place on an assembly.
      • Working under a microscope to place and adjust small components.
      • Using tweezers to pick up, place, and manipulate small components.
      • Performing work in a laminar flow hood.
      • Possible operation of a basic test system to gather pass/fail information from assemblies.
      • This position works in an ESD-sensitive and ITAR-compliant work area.
